Contents to note when drafting a commercial contract

A commercial contract is an important legal document in business transactions. According to Vietnamese law, drafting a contract not only requires accuracy in content but also compliance with current legal regulations. Below are contents to note when drafting a commercial contract in Vietnam.

  1. Ensuring the legality of the contract

First of all, the contract must comply with the provisions of the Civil Code and the Commercial Law of Vietnam. The contract will not be legally valid if the content violates the law or is contrary to social ethics. Therefore, the parties need to ensure that the terms of the contract are not contrary to the provisions of current law.

  1. Clearly identify the parties to the contract

In a commercial contract, clearly identifying the parties is very important. It is necessary to fully state information such as name, address, tax code (for enterprises) and the rights and obligations of each party. This helps avoid unnecessary disputes later.

  1. Specific and clear contract content

The content of the contract must be complete, clear and detailed. The terms of the contract, price, implementation time, payment method, responsibilities and rights of the parties must be clearly stated. Using simple language, avoiding ambiguous words will help the parties easily understand and perform the contract.

  1. Consider the adjustment and compensation provisions

The contract must have provisions on adjustment if there are changes during the implementation process. The parties also need to clearly agree on the compensation for damages in case one party fails to perform or does not fully perform its obligations. This will help protect the rights of the parties and minimize risks.

  1. Compliance with regulations on contract form

According to Vietnamese law, some types of commercial contracts need to be made in writing to have legal value, such as real estate sale and purchase contracts or loan contracts with collateral or mortgage. Therefore, the parties need to pay attention to the form of the contract to ensure its validity.

  1. Checking and monitoring contract performance

Finally, after the contract is signed, the parties need to monitor the implementation of the obligations and rights in the contract. This not only helps ensure proper implementation of commitments but also creates favorable conditions for resolving disputes if they arise.

  1. Conclusion

Drafting a commercial contract is an important step in the transaction process. Paying attention to the above issues will help the parties protect their legitimate rights and minimize risks in business. A clear, legal and fair contract will contribute to creating a stable and sustainable business environment.
